自動生成された述語行テンプレートのNSDatePickerの変更
-
03-07-2019 - |
質問
[NSPredicateRowEditorTemplate templatesWithAttributeKeyPaths:inEntityDescription:によって返される
? NSDate
プロパティの行テンプレートの NSDatePicker
の NSDatePickerElementFlags
を変更するにはどうすればよいですか? ] NSDatePicker
に、日付だけでなくhrs:minutesも表示したいです。
更新 cocoa-devリストから収集した回答を以下に追加しました。
解決 2
Peter Ammon氏、cocoa-devについて、Benが指摘しているように、最も簡単な方法は、 -templateViews
の日付ピッカーを直接変更することです。
[[[template templateViews] objectAtIndex:2] setDatePickerElements:...]
ピーターによれば、 -templateViews
の要素の順序は一定であることが保証されています。
他のヒント
おそらく、返された行テンプレートの templateViews
をざっと見て、このプロパティを設定できます。
所属していません StackOverflow